LTY 478P is a 1976 Triumph Tr 7 in White with a 1,998cc petrol engine. This vehicle has been through 15 MOT tests with a personal pass rate of 60%.
Across all 1976 Triumph Tr 7 models, the average MOT pass rate is 71.3% with a typical mileage of 62,721 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Triumph Tr 7 f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 1,278 recorded failures. If you're considering buying LTY 478P, it's worth having these areas checked by a mechanic before committing.
The Triumph Tr 7 typically stays on UK roads for around 50 years. At 50 years old, this Triumph Tr 7 is approaching the upper end of the typical lifespan for this model.
